Fluffy Keto Flaxseed Bread

This fluffy keto flaxseed bread is an ideal choice for those who follow a low-carb, high-fat lifestyle. Made with a blend of ground flaxseed, almond flour, and eggs, it results in a soft and airy texture that is perfect for sandwiches or as a side to your meal. It’s packed with fiber and omega-3 fatty acids, making it not only delicious but also nutritious. The recipe is simple, quick to prepare, and can easily be stored for a few days, offering you a convenient keto-friendly bread option.

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up ground flaxseed
  • 1/4 cup almond flour
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1/4 cup unsweetened almond milk
  • 1/4 cup olive oil or melted butter
  • 1 tbs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p garlic powder (optional)
  • 1 tbsp sesame seeds (optional, for topping)

Instructions:

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a loaf pan with olive oil or line it with parchment paper.
  • In a large mixing bowl, combine ground flaxseed, almond flour, baking powder, salt, and garlic powder (if using). Stir to combine.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s, almond milk, and olive oil (or melted butter).
  •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and stir until a thick batter forms.
  •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top with a spatula.
  • Sprinkle sesame seeds on top, if desired.
  •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until the top is golden and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  • Let the bread cool for 10 minutes in the pan, then trans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ely.

This keto flaxseed bread has a delightful texture with a slight nutty flavor. It’s an excellent low-carb alternative to traditional bread, making it perfect for sandwiches or as a side for soups. The seeds on top add a bit of crunch, enhancing the bread’s overall appeal. The bread also stays moist for several days, making it a great meal prep option for those following the keto diet.

Keto Flaxseed Bread with Cheese

This keto flaxseed bread with cheese is an indulgent twist on the classic keto bread recipe. By adding shredded cheese, the bread becomes rich, savory, and full of flavor. It’s the perfect accompaniment to a hearty meal or can be enjoyed on its own with butter. The cheese also helps to keep the bread moist and adds an extra layer of richness that complements the nutty taste of the flaxseed. It’s a versatile bread that works well for various occasions.

Ingredients:

  • 1 1/2 cups ground flaxseed
  • 1/4 cup coconut flour
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ese (or cheese of choice)
  • 1/4 cup olive oil or melted butter
  • 1 tbs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per
  • 1/4 cup water

Instructions:

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ease or line a loaf pan with parchment paper.
  • In a large bowl, mix together ground flaxseed, coconut flour, baking powder, salt, and black pepper.
  • In another bowl, whisk together the eggs, olive oil (or melted butter), and water.
  • Combine the wet ingredients with the dry ingredients and stir until well mixed. The batter will be thick.
  • Fold in the shredded cheddar cheese, ensuring it’s evenly distributed throughout the batter.
  • Transfer the batter to the prepared loaf pan, smoothing out the top with a spatula.
  • Bake for 35-40 minutes or until the bread is golden brown and a toothpick comes out clean when inserted into the center.
  • Allow the bread to c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.

This cheese-infused keto flaxseed bread offers a mouthwatering combination of savory flavors with the richness of melted cheese. The addition of coconut flour gives the bread a slightly different texture, making it even more satisfying. The bread holds its shape well, so you can slice it without it falling apart. It’s a great option for those craving a more indulgent, yet low-carb, bread experience.

Keto Flaxseed Bread with Chia Seeds

Keto flaxseed bread with chia seeds is an excellent option for those looking for a bread that’s both rich in fiber and packed with omega-3 fatty acids. Chia seeds are known for their ability to absorb liquid and form a gel-like consistency, which helps create a moist, soft bread. This bread is great for those following a keto or low-carb diet and looking for a nutritious, filling option. With the nutty flavor of flaxseed and the slight crunch of chia seeds, it’s perfect for sandwiches or as a side dish.

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up ground flaxseed
  • 1/4 cup almond flour
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1/4 cup unsweetened almond milk
  • 1/4 cup olive oil or melted butter
  • 1 tbs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 2 tbsp chia seeds
  • 1/4 cup water

Instructions:

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ease or line a loaf pan with parchment paper.
  • In a large mixing bowl, combine ground flaxseed, almond flour, baking powder, salt, and chia seeds.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s, almond milk, olive oil (or melted butter), and water.
  • Add the wet ingredients to the dry mixture and stir until fully combined. The chia seeds will begin to absorb moisture and help bind the dough.
  •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top with a spatula.
  • Bake for 30-35 minutes or until the bread is golden brown and a toothpick comes out clean.
  • Allow the bread to c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.

The chia seeds in this keto flaxseed bread add a boost of fiber and healthy fats, making this bread a filling and nutritious option for anyone on a low-carb diet. The texture is soft and moist, with a slight crunch from the chia seeds that complement the heartiness of the flaxseed. This bread is perfect for those seeking an easy-to-make, nutrient-packed option that satisfies your cravings without compromising your keto goals.

Keto Flaxseed Bread with Zucchini

Keto flaxseed bread with zucchini is a delicious and moisture-packed loaf that incorporates vegetables for an extra boost of nutrients. The zucchini helps keep the bread moist, while the flaxseed provides fiber and healthy fats. This bread is a great way to sneak in some extra veggies without sacrificing taste. The subtle flavor of the zucchini blends beautifully with the nutty flaxseed, making it an excellent choice for breakfast, snacks, or as a side dish with your favorite meal.

Ingredients:

  • 1 1/2 cups ground flaxseed
  • 1/4 cup almond flour
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1/4 cup unsweetened almond milk
  • 1/4 cup olive oil or melted butter
  • 1 tbs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 medium zucchini, grated
  • 1 tsp garlic powder (optional)

Instructions:

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ease or line a loaf pan with parchment paper.
  • In a large bowl, combine ground flaxseed, almond flour, baking powder, salt, and garlic powder (if using).
  • In another bowl, whisk together the eggs, almond milk, and olive oil (or melted butter).
  • Fold in the grated zucchini to the wet mixture.
  •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and stir until fully combined.
  •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top.
  •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until the bread is golden br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  • Allow the bread to c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.

The zucchini in this keto flaxseed bread adds moisture and a subtle, earthy flavor that complements the flaxseed’s nuttiness. The bread is tender and soft, making it a perfect snack or meal accompaniment. This loaf is not only delicious but also a great way to add extra vegetables to your low-carb diet without compromising on flavor or texture.
